Youth For Global Action

       

 

  Who We Are:

 

YFGA, or Youth for Global Action is dedicated to the betterment of our world, one dollar at a time. Made up of a dedicated group of students, YFGA plans and carries out events both at Glenforest Secondary School, and in the local community. Since its conception, Youth for Global Action has had two main goals: awareness and fundraising. To the awareness end, each year YFGA hosts International Development Day (IDD), a chance for students of Glenforest to hear expert speakers from a variety of fields discuss global development issues in their respective lines of work and what is being done to solve them. After the presentations at IDD, the floor is opened to questions and a lively discussion between students and speakers follows.  
  What We Do:  

 

 

Each year, YFGA general council members vote and select an international aid organization to support. In reflecting the values of the school and the community, the charity selected is always secular, non-partisan and have minimal overhead costs. Through a variety of events including bake sales, Valentine’s Day Rose delivery and a school carnival, YFGA raises funds to donate to the charity selected. 100% of the money collected by YFGA goes directly to the aid organization chosen.
In its endeavours, YFGA is greatly supported by Glenforest Secondary School’s International Baccalaureate Student League (IBSL), Student Activity Council (SAC), the organizing council for the Talent Show, and the Glenforest student body.
